BEIJING, Feb. 12 (Reporter Wu Tao) "The red envelope is so big, I want to try it."
It has become a "New Year custom" for Internet companies to give out red envelopes during the Spring Festival. Alipay is divided into 500 million in Five Blessingg, 1 billion in today’s headlines, 2 billion in Tik Tok, 2.1 billion in Aauto Quicker, 2.2 billion in Baidu, and 2.8 billion in Pinduoduo. Just a few Internet "big factories", giving out red envelopes during the Spring Festival exceeded 10 billion yuan. How much did you rob?

For example, Five Blessingg is divided into 500 million yuan, but over 300 million people have gathered together. In this way, each person is divided into more than one yuan on average.

In addition, you can’t withdraw the money if you want. Many platforms stipulate that you can’t withdraw the money below 1 yuan. The money in many red envelopes must also be withdrawn within a limited time, and it will be invalid after expiration. Many netizens don’t take the trouble to withdraw cash, or the red envelopes are too small to be taken out at all. Therefore, I am afraid that only the enterprises themselves know how much they actually send out.

"Visiting, singing and answering questions", you can’t grab a red envelope without a talent.
Although the share is small, there are only a few people who "grab the red envelope for fun, and I really need the money for the New Year", and the battle for grabbing the red envelope has been lengthened this year. It turned out that the lottery was held on New Year’s Eve, but this year some red envelope activities continued until the sixth day of the Lunar New Year.
For example, some platforms have released a red envelope, which supports video for the first time. Users can create online homes, record videos, send red envelopes, invite friends and relatives to collect them, pass on New Year greetings, or visit other homes to ask for red envelopes.

There are also team red envelopes, answering red envelopes, and karaoke red envelopes. Take the K-song red envelope as an example. When grabbing a red envelope, you need to sing, and you can only get it if you sing correctly. Some analysts pointed out that for Internet companies, the centralized competition in the Spring Festival can be avoided from being too homogeneous, which increases the interactivity and interest.
It is worth noting that when Internet giants are frantically "throwing money", WeChat, the originator of red envelopes, has taken a different approach, going further and further on the cover of red envelopes, and everything can "sell skin", and red envelopes are no exception.
Unlike last year, this year’s WeChat red envelope cover is conditionally open to individuals, and the price has also dropped to 1 yuan/piece. In 2020, the cover of red envelopes will only be customized for enterprises and some institutions, and the price will be 10 yuan/piece, with a minimum order of 100.

Meng Huixin, an analyst at the Legal Rights Department of the Research Center for E-Commerce, said that there are various ways to play red envelopes. When users play red envelopes, they should pay attention to the source of red envelopes, mainly because the red envelopes with Trojan horses are more technical and hidden, such as red envelopes that need to input payee information, AA red envelopes, red envelopes that need to enter passwords, and red envelopes that share links.
Pay attention to safety when presenting red envelopes. It is understood that at present, many accounts are bound to sensitive information such as the user’s real name, mobile phone number and bank card. Even new users need to enter this information when presenting red envelopes.
I would like to remind you that when presenting red envelopes on some unknown platforms, don’t be greedy and cheap, and don’t enter some personal sensitive information such as name, bank card and telephone number to prevent being deceived.
Meng Huixin said that in addition to users’ vigilance, when the platform engages in the Spring Festival red envelope activities, it must do a good job in data information protection measures to avoid user information leakage. (End)
